bọc da
Definition
- Noun:
- A leather sack / a skin wrapper: A literal meaning referring to a covering or sack made from animal hide or leather.
- To die on the battlefield: A figurative and literary idiom meaning a soldier's death in combat, with the connotation of being wrapped in one's own skin (or uniform) for burial where one fell.
Usage Examples
- Literal:
- Anh ấy cất đồ trong một cái bọc da. (He keeps his things in a leather sack.)
- Figurative (Idiomatic):
- Người lính trẻ đã bọc da ngoài chiến trường. (The young soldier died on the battlefield.)
Advanced Usage
- The term "bọc da" is almost exclusively used in its idiomatic, figurative sense in modern Vietnamese, particularly in literary, historical, or formal contexts to honor military sacrifice. The literal meaning is understood but rarely the primary usage.
Variants and Related Words
- Tử trận (v): to die in battle. This is a more common, direct synonym for the figurative meaning of "bọc da".
- Hàng nghìn chiến sĩ đã tử trận. (Thousands of soldiers died in battle.)

Related Idioms
- Da ngựa bọc thây: (Literally: horsehide wraps the corpse) An idiom with a similar meaning, emphasizing a heroic death in battle and being buried wrapped in a horse's hide.
- Ước nguyện của ông là được da ngựa bọc thây. (His wish was to die a heroic death in battle.)
